The Talabat delivery menu page covers items and prices only, with no allergen or dietary practice details included.fetched May 29, 2026Although the restaurant is vegetarian-only, dairy is used heavily in nearly all South Indian dishes. The HappyCow listing notes that vegan options include dosas, mini tiffin, poori korma and some daily specials, but advises vegans to ask to omit butter and yogurt. The kitchen is not dedicated to vegan cooking, so cross-contact with dairy is likely. Stating dietary needs clearly and confirming with the chef when ordering is advisable.
